Grabner Instrument vapor pressure method accepted for ASTM D4814 automotive fuel specifications!

SHARE
Dec. 22, 2009
Testing vapor pressure for automotive gasolines no longer requires time consuming sample preparation! Recently the ASTM Subcommittee D02.A for petroleum products unanimously voted to include the GRABNER INSTRUMENTS Vapor Pressure method ASTM D6378 as an alternative test method into ASTM D4814 – the Standard Specification for Automotive Spark-Ignition Engine Fuels.

Thousands of customers worldwide prefer the GRABNER INSTRUMENTS method ASTM D6378 over the commonly used methods D4953, D5190, D5191, or D5482. The ASTM included the new method into automotive fuel specifications D4814-09a, as the advantages of ASTM D6378 are obvious:

  • No cooling and air saturation of samples necessary
  • No external vacuum pump necessary
  • Faster and bias-free results

Cooling and air saturation is not required in ASTM D6378, the Test Method for Determination of Vapor Pressure (VPx) of Petroleum Products, Hydrocarbons, and Hydrocarbon-Oxygenate Mixtures (Triple Expansion Method). Thus errors commonly resulting from improper air saturation procedure are eliminated and accuracy is improved. In addition, GRABNER INSTRUMENTS Vapor Pressure Testers are approved by the U.S. Environmental Protection Agency and the California Air Resources Board for determining compliance with U.S. federal and state vapor pressure regulations.

Measurements according to ASTM D6378 VPx-method can easily be performed by the recently launched GRABNER INSTRUMENTS MINIVAP VPXpert vapor pressure tester. As required by automotive fuel specifications the MINIVAP VPXpert also displays the dry vapor equivalent (DVPE).
